首先,項目中往往時間的原因,無法將整個項目的代碼完完整整的通讀一遍,而且將整個代碼完全理解透也不切實際。而且很多情況下一期項目完后,很少有人會將項目內的代碼完完整整的進行關鍵性注釋。這個時候針對性模塊理解起到了一定的關鍵作用。
針對自己在項目中要增加、修改的模塊花些時間進行理解很重要,而且因為時間原因,一旦遇到了不理解的地方不能一直死盯着,需要合理的跳過。很多項目中,模塊之間是相互聯系的,雖然在此模塊中不能將一部分代碼理解,但是往往到另一個模塊中卻會驚奇的發現:之前模塊中遇到的不理解的代碼片段在此模塊中會很容易的理解出來。